          <section eId="part-VA__dvs-1__sec-67AA">
            <num>67AA</num>
            <heading>Purpose of Part</heading>
            <content>
              <p>The purpose of this Part is to provide for the winding down of the operations of the Commission prior to the Commission being abolished by the repeal of this Act.</p>
            </content>
          </section>
          <section eId="part-VA__dvs-1__sec-67AB">
            <num>67AB</num>
            <heading>Simplified outline</heading>
            <content>
              <p>The following is a simplified outline of this Part:</p>
              <p>•	This Part sets up a scheme under which assets of the Commission may be transferred to other persons.</p>
              <p>•	The Commission may be directed to sell or transfer any of its assets.</p>
              <p>•	The assets, contracts and liabilities of the Commission may be transferred by declaration.</p>
              <p>•	Commonwealth guaranteed liabilities may, however, only be transferred to the Commonwealth.</p>
              <p>•	If assets, contracts or liabilities (other than Commonwealth guaranteed liabilities) of the Commission have been transferred to the Commonwealth, the assets, contracts or liabilities may be transferred by the Commonwealth to other persons.</p>
              <p>•	The Commission may be required to pay to the Commonwealth an amount equal to any consideration received for the sale or transfer of any of the Commission’s assets or contracts.</p>
              <p>•	Certain transactions under this Part are exempt from stamp duty and similar taxes.</p>
              <p>•	The Commonwealth may take over obligations of the Commission.</p>
              <p>•	The Commission, the Commissioners, and certain other persons, may be required to assist the Commonwealth or the Commission in connection with the implementation of this Part.</p>
              <p>•	The Federal Court may grant injunctions relating to the enforcement of this Part.</p>
              <p>•	Provision is made for compensation for acquisition of property.</p>
            </content>
          </section>

          <section eId="part-VA__dvs-10__sec-67AZS">
            <num>67AZS</num>
            <heading>Compensation—constitutional safety net</heading>
            <subsection eId="part-VA__dvs-10__sec-67AZS__subsec-1">
              <num>1</num>
              <content>
                <p>If:</p>
              </content>
              <content>
                <p>(a)	apart from this section, the operation of this Part would result in the acquisition of property from a person otherwise than on just terms; and</p>
                <p>(b)	the acquisition would be invalid because of paragraph 51(xxxi) of the Constitution;</p>
                <p>the Commonwealth is liable to pay compensation of a reasonable amount to the person in respect of the acquisition.</p>
              </content>
            </subsection>
            <subsection eId="part-VA__dvs-10__sec-67AZS__subsec-2">
              <num>2</num>
              <content>
                <p>If the Commonwealth and the person do not agree on the amount of the compensation, the person may institute proceedings in the Federal Court for the recovery from the Commonwealth of such reasonable amount of compensation as the Court determines.</p>
              </content>
            </subsection>
            <subsection eId="part-VA__dvs-10__sec-67AZS__subsec-3">
              <num>3</num>
              <content>
                <p>Any damages or compensation recovered, or other remedy given, in a proceeding begun otherwise than under this section must be taken into account in assessing compensation payable in a proceeding begun under this section and arising out of the same event or transaction.</p>
              </content>
            </subsection>
            <subsection eId="part-VA__dvs-10__sec-67AZS__subsec-4">
              <num>4</num>
              <content>
                <p>In this section:</p>
              </content>
              <content>
                <p><b><i>acquisition of property</i></b> has the same meaning as in paragraph 51(xxxi) of the Constitution.</p>
                <p><b><i>just terms</i></b> has the same meaning as in paragraph 51(xxxi) of the Constitution.</p>
              </content>
            </subsection>
          </section>

          <section eId="part-VA__dvs-10__sec-74A">
            <num>74A</num>
            <heading>Operation of certain State and Territory laws</heading>
            <subsection eId="part-VA__dvs-10__sec-74A__subsec-1">
              <num>1</num>
              <content>
                <p>The Commission, in operating railways, is subject to any law of a State or Territory that specifically relates to the safety in the operation of railways.</p>
              </content>
            </subsection>
            <subsection eId="part-VA__dvs-10__sec-74A__subsec-2">
              <num>2</num>
              <content>
                <p>Subject to subsection (3), a person who operates a railway that was previously operated by the Commission is, in operating the railway, subject to all laws of a State or Territory that relate to the operation of railways.</p>
              </content>
            </subsection>
            <subsection eId="part-VA__dvs-10__sec-74A__subsec-3">
              <num>3</num>
              <content>
                <p>	(3)	The Minister may, by written notice published in the <i>Gazette</i>, declare that specified laws of a State or Territory that relate to the operation of railways do not apply to a specified person who operates a railway that was previously operated by the Commission.</p>
              </content>
            </subsection>
            <subsection eId="part-VA__dvs-10__sec-74A__subsec-4">
              <num>4</num>
              <content>
                <p>A declaration under subsection (3) must specify the period during which it has effect. The period must end no later than 6 months after the Commission ceases to operate the railway concerned.</p>
              </content>
            </subsection>
            <subsection eId="part-VA__dvs-10__sec-74A__subsec-5">
              <num>5</num>
              <content>
                <p>A declaration made under subsection (3) has effect accordingly.</p>

      <part eId="part-2">
        <num>2</num>
        <heading>Access to railways for defence-related purposes etc.</heading>
        <content>
          <p>2  Access to railways for defence-related purposes and for emergency or disaster relief</p>
        </content>
        <subsection eId="part-2__subsec-1">
          <num>1</num>
          <content>
            <p><role refersTo="#minister">The Minister</role> may, by written notice given to a person who manages or controls a railway previously managed or controlled by the Commission:</p>
          </content>
          <content>
            <p>(a)	require that access be given to specified kinds of railway services for specified kinds of defence-related purposes; or</p>
            <p>(b)	require that priority of access be given to specified kinds of railway services for specified kinds of defence-related purposes.</p>
          </content>
        </subsection>
        <subsection eId="part-2__subsec-2">
          <num>2</num>
          <content>
            <p>The manner in which that access, or priority of access, is to be given is to be set out in the notice.</p>
          </content>
        </subsection>
        <subsection eId="part-2__subsec-3">
          <num>3</num>
          <content>
            <p>Subject to item 3, the terms and conditions on which that access, or priority of access, is to be given are to be set out in the notice.</p>
          </content>
        </subsection>
        <subsection eId="part-2__subsec-4">
          <num>4</num>
          <content>
            <p>A person must comply with a notice given to it under subitem (1).</p>
          </content>
        </subsection>
        <subsection eId="part-2__subsec-5">
          <num>5</num>
          <content>
            <p>A contravention of subitem (4) is not an offence. However, a contravention of subitem (4) is a ground for obtaining an injunction.</p>
          </content>
        </subsection>
        <subsection eId="part-2__subsec-6">
          <num>6</num>
          <content>
            <p>In addition to other methods of giving a notice, a notice under subitem (1) may be given by facsimile transmission.</p>
          </content>
        </subsection>
        <subsection eId="part-2__subsec-7">
          <num>7</num>
          <content>
            <p>In addition to its effect apart from this subitem, this item has the effect it would have if each reference to a person who manages or controls a railway previously managed or controlled by the Commission were, by express provision, confined to such a person that is a constitutional corporation.</p>
          </content>
        </subsection>
        <subsection eId="part-2__subsec-8">
          <num>8</num>
          <content>
            <p>In this item:</p>
          </content>
          <content>
            <p><b><i>Commission</i></b> means the Australian National Railways Commission.</p>
            <p><b><i>railway service</i></b> means a service provided in the course of conducting or managing a railway, and includes the use of facilities that are used for those purposes.</p>
            <p><b><i>defence-related purpose</i></b> means a purpose related to any of the following:</p>
            <p>(a)	the defence of Australia;</p>
            <p>(b)	the operation of the Australian Defence Force in connection with the defence of Australia;</p>
            <p>(c)	the transport of the armed forces of a foreign country in connection with the defence of Australia;</p>
            <p>(d)	the operation of the Australian Defence Force in connection with international humanitarian aid or United Nations peace-keeping operations;</p>
            <p>(e)	the management of an emergency or a disaster (whether natural or otherwise), where that management involves the Australian Defence Force.</p>
